description

CPI is part of the High value Manufacturing Catapult – a network of research and technology Organisations in the UK whose role is to assist companies to accelerate and de-risk the introduction of new products and technologies. CPI is proposing to build a new National Centre for Healthcare Photonics at NETPark. The aim of the new centre will be to create jobs and increase the amount of economic activity in the North East of England and nationally. Healthcare Photonics is about the use of light as a key enabling technology in Therapies, Imaging and Diagnostics for healthcare. The project is being part funded by the North East Local Enterprise Partnership (NELEP) with money from the Local growth Fund. The NELEP have approved the grant funding for Phase 1 of this project, which is to design, plan and cost the building infrastructure in the project to RIBA Stage 3 (ready for Tender to build). Phase 1 is expected to last for approximately 9 months. If, successful, Phase 1 is expected to lead to the submission of a full business case and approval, by the NELEP, of a provisionally allocated amount of £10million of grant funding for the remainder of the project. The whole project duration is expected to be 5 years.

We require a project manager to serve for an initial 9 month period, starting immediately, to carry out project management as part of Phase 1 of CPIs National Centre for Healthcare Photonics. The project has been funded through the Local Growth Fund from the North East Local Enterprise Partnership. The appointed person will work within a project team comprising of; project lead, members of the project board and technical champions with specific expertise to contribute.

If the project progresses to full design and build, CPI may decide to retain the project manager throughout the entire project and as such we reserve the right to modify this contract to cover project management services beyond the initial 9 months and throughout the design and build phase up to completion of the project.
